Output 59fcdfc619a98c12159a309e8f49545775062a704586aeda3783fcebc2f263e8:5

value
150768769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50c1856f82136e49286540821ebf3f7f1656325 OP_EQUAL
address
MRs3qbqb2F6V2fteLZ38fP3NFoo7ZqRikW
transaction
59fcdfc619a98c12159a309e8f49545775062a704586aeda3783fcebc2f263e8
spent
true